How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Boston?
| Bedroom | Average Price | Cheapest Price | Highest Price |
|---|---|---|---|
| Boston Studio Apartments | $2,569 | $868 | $9,800 |
| Boston 1 Bedroom Apartments | $3,010 | $845 | $10,000+ |
| Boston 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,714 | $300 | $10,000+ |
| Boston 3 Bedroom Apartments | $4,272 | $1,000 | $10,000+ |
| Boston 4 Bedroom Apartments | $5,107 | $870 | $10,000+ |
| Boston 5 Bedroom Apartments | $6,372 | $1,110 | $10,000+ |
| Boston 6 Bedroom Apartments | $8,303 | $4,000 | $10,000+ |
